Output 15f98e3a8a1c5984097503c7aa981c1bdfe6256d73b807d3d697951af7971a06:1

value
2684347
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a7939b1e5176a50d1d594658213d74cc4335f595 OP_EQUAL
address
3Gy5bRGvPRYcYqYP2XakELmPur6pbaqnZv
transaction
15f98e3a8a1c5984097503c7aa981c1bdfe6256d73b807d3d697951af7971a06
confirmations
258242
spent
true